PiggDogg Posted June 26, 2004 Share Posted June 26, 2004 Moral to you story is: Don't buy silly uber tanks like JadgTigers or JadgPanthers. :eek: Buy cheaper JadgPzIVs &, especially JadgPzIV/70s. These TDs are nearly just as effective as those giant point wasting uber tanks, and you get more of them. Just keep these tanks' fronts aimed toward any potential enemy threats. Also, do not get within 200 meters of any covering terrain that might contain any enemy infantry AT teams. Cheers, Richard 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
LT. James Cater Posted June 30, 2004 Share Posted June 30, 2004 Belive me it happens at the worst times too. PiggDogg has it right. the best protection against AT teams is having your own infantry nearby.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
